Mercenary Premier Acquires Edna Valley Facility to Launch Comprehensive Winemaking Services

Published June 23, 2026

We were proud to be featured by Wine Industry Advisor following the acquisition of our new Edna Valley production facility and the launch of Mercenary Premier's expanded custom crush and winemaking services. The announcement marked an important milestone for our team and our continued investment in the Central Coast wine industry.

The article highlights our evolution from mobile bottling and canning services into a full-scale production partner offering custom vinification, bulk wine services, laboratory support, and flexible packaging solutions. By combining Jason Fullmer's operational experience with Josh Baker's decades of winemaking leadership, Mercenary Premier was built to support brands from harvest through final package.

Read the article here →

Located in the heart of Edna Valley, the facility provides the infrastructure needed to serve wineries and beverage producers at a variety of scales while remaining focused on one mission: helping other brands succeed. Unlike many wineries that balance custom work alongside their own labels, Mercenary Premier exists exclusively to provide production, packaging, and winemaking services for clients.

For us, this expansion represents more than a new building. It reflects our belief that independent wineries deserve an experienced, operator-led partner that understands every stage of the process—from vineyard to bottle, can, keg, or bag-in-box. We are excited to continue investing in San Luis Obispo County and supporting the next generation of Central Coast beverage brands.

We were honored to be featured by The San Luis Obispo Tribune following our acquisition of the former Baileyana Winery production facility in Edna Valley. The article highlighted the partnership between Jason Fullmer and Josh Baker and the vision behind building Mercenary Premier as a dedicated custom crush, winemaking, and packaging operation in San Luis Obispo County.

The story explores what makes Mercenary Premier different: an operator-led business focused exclusively on supporting other brands. Rather than producing our own label or operating a tasting room, our mission is to provide custom crush, bottling, canning, and winemaking services for wineries and beverage companies throughout the Central Coast and beyond.

Read the article here →

The article also notes the scale of the Edna Valley facility, which includes more than 43,000 square feet of production space and will be fully operational for the 2026 harvest. For us, the investment represents more than growth—it reflects our long-term commitment to the Central Coast wine industry and to building a business rooted in local relationships, technical expertise, and flexible production solutions.

As Josh shared with The Tribune, Mercenary Premier was created by combining decades of winemaking experience with a shared belief that independent brands deserve a dedicated production partner. We are proud to continue investing in Edna Valley and look forward to helping wineries and beverage producers bring exceptional products to market.
